B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, particularly formulated for feed-grade use and analyzed to fulfill stringent high-quality and protection benchmarks. BHT is usually a lipophilic natural and organic compound that may be generally made use of being an antioxidant in a variety of industrial programs. In animal nourishment, BHT FEED GRADE TEST is greatly applied to avoid the oxidation of fats and oils in animal feed, thereby preserving the nutritional benefit and lengthening the shelf life of the feed. Oxidized fats don't just eliminate nutritional efficacy but could also create harmful compounds, influencing the overall health and development of livestock. The inclusion of BHT in feed requires demanding testing to guarantee it adheres to regulatory specifications and it is Harmless for usage by animals, which eventually enters the human food items chain. The testing protocols ordinarily assess the purity, efficacy, and probable residues in animal tissues.
Yet another vital compound inside the chemical area is Pentachloropyridine. This compound is really a chlorinated spinoff of pyridine and it has garnered curiosity resulting from its utility as an intermediate inside the synthesis of agrochemicals, dyes, and prescription drugs. Its higher degree of chlorination causes it to be a strong compound, which needs to be dealt with with treatment as a consequence of possible toxicity and environmental worries. Pentachloropyridine serves as a creating block in chemical synthesis, letting chemists to develop much more intricate molecules Which may be Employed in herbicides, insecticides, or simply specialty polymers. The handling and disposal of Pentachloropyridine are controlled, given its possible environmental persistence and bioaccumulation threat. Industries working with this compound usually adopt closed-program creation approaches and demanding basic safety protocols to reduce exposure.
M-Phenylene Diamine, generally abbreviated as MPD, is surely an aromatic amine that characteristics prominently while in the manufacture of aramid fibers, which can be nicely-known for their warmth resistance and energy. Kevlar and Nomex, used in body armor and fireplace-resistant garments, respectively, are made making use of MPD as a vital precursor. The compound by itself is made up of a benzene ring with two amino groups during the meta positions, which makes it appropriate for making polymers with attractive thermal and mechanical Homes. M-Phenylene Diamine (MPD) can also be Employed in the dye market, especially in hair dyes as well as other beauty applications, Whilst its use has become curtailed in certain areas as a consequence of basic safety concerns. When production products that contains MPD, good occupational security practices are vital to safeguard staff from extended exposure, which could lead to sk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), whilst structurally much like MPD, differs during the positioning from the amino groups, which appreciably influences its chemical reactivity and software. OPDA is commonly employed within the manufacture of dyes and pigments, wherever it contributes into the development of vivid colors which can be steady and prolonged-Long lasting. It is additionally Employed in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s job in corrosion inhibitors and rubber chemicals additional highlights its versatility. Nevertheless, similar to other aromatic amines, OPDA can also be connected with toxicity hazards, and therefore, its use is very carefully controlled and monitored. The importance of correct managing, ideal storage, and enough protective measures can not be overstated when working with OPDA in any industrial setting.
Pinacolone is yet another noteworthy compound with several different apps. This is a ketone With all the molecular formula C6H12O and is particularly applied mostly as an intermediate from the synthesis of pesticides and herbicides, notably within the creation of triazole fungicides and specified plant growth regulators. Pinacolone’s framework includes a tertiary butyl team, which contributes Pinacolone to its distinctive reactivity in organic and natural synthesis. Past agriculture, it will also be present in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its capability to undertake nucleophilic substitution and condensation reactions, making it a precious reagent in laboratory and industrial processes. Even though it is considerably less harmful than several of the Beforehand mentioned compounds, basic safety safety measures remain essential to mitigate any challenges related to its volatility and likely irritant Attributes.
2-Heptanone is actually a ketone that Obviously takes place in certain plants and can also be present in modest portions in human sweat and sure animal secretions. It is usually Employed in the fragrance and taste industries because of its pleasant, fruity odor. Furthermore, 2-Heptanone has located apps being a solvent and intermediate in organic and natural synthesis. Curiously, exploration has prompt that it may well Participate in a job in chemical signaling, specially in insects, wherever it functions as an alarm pheromone. This has led to its study in pest Manage methods and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its somewhat very low toxicity causes it to be appropriate for use in buyer goods, Even though appropriate labeling and managing Guidelines are often mandated.
